You’ve got the website, you’ve got the content, but how are people going to know it’s there?
A great website plays an increasingly crucial role in helping a business to grow and achieve its objectives – and in order to grow, you need to know how to drive customers to your site.
There are several different methods, such as paid advertising, blogging, email marketing, and social media. They each have their own distinct advantages and disadvantages, and we'll give you an overview of each.
With all this focus on the virtual world, how do you promote a website offline? We'll also take you through the pros and cons of building up a customer base through such means as networking, traditional print media, billboard campaigns, and television.
